Senior Brand Manager, Personal Care / OTC
Location: South West London x 3 days in the office
TalentPool are delighted to partner with a global branded Personal Care business based in Richmond who are looking to hire an experienced Senior Brand Manager to work on 3 of their high performing brands!
The role is broad and will work in a close-knit team of marketeers reporting into the UK General Manager.
What You’ll Lead
- Develop and execute UK marketing strategy across all categories, aligned to long‑term sales, profit, and growth goals.
- Own full P&L management: forecasting, pricing, budget control, profitability, and commercial planning.
- Analyse brand, category, and consumer trends using Circana/EPOS and other data sources — turning insights into actionable growth plans.
- Lead new product launches, packaging changes, and brand renovations from concept to execution.
- Build and optimise media plans with agency partners; oversee social strategy across Facebook, Instagram, and influencer channels.
- Drive marketing mix excellence and adapt global communication assets for the UK market.
- Collaborate with international marketing, media, R&D, regulatory, supply chain, finance, and UK sales teams.
- Manage one direct report and foster a high‑performance, growth‑oriented culture.
What You Bring
- 6–10 years’ experience in a blue‑chip FMCG / Personal Care or OTC environment, ideally multinational.
- Strong cross‑functional exposure across Marketing, Sales, or Customer Marketing.
- Proven ability to turn data into compelling commercial stories and growth strategies.
- Deep understanding of the UK retail landscape and consumer behaviour.
- Experience leading agencies and managing complex stakeholder groups.
- A self‑starter mindset: proactive, analytical, collaborative, and comfortable challenging the status quo.
